| Name | chromosome 14 open reading frame 28 |
| Description | Predicted to act upstream of or within with a positive effect on NMDA selective glutamate receptor signaling pathway and cAMP-mediated signaling. Predicted to act upstream of or within several processes, including G protein-coupled dopamine receptor signaling pathway; memory; and neurogenesis. [provided by Alliance of Genome Resources, Mar 2025] |

{"type": "root", "children": [{"type": "p", "children": [{"type": "t", "text": "\n C14orf28 (also known as dopamine receptor‐interacting protein 1, DRIP1) has emerged as a multifunctional protein that may contribute to both neuropsychiatric and oncogenic processes. In the context of brain disorders, altered expression of C14orf28 has been observed in postmortem prefrontal cortex samples from individuals with schizophrenia and bipolar disorder. Here, its expression is part of a tightly correlated network of genes involved in dopamine signaling, suggesting that dysregulation of C14orf28 might contribute to the pathogenesis of these conditions."}, {"type": "fg", "children": [{"type": "fg_f", "ref": "1"}]}, {"type": "t", "text": ""}]}, {"type": "t", "text": "\n \n "}, {"type": "p", "children": [{"type": "t", "text": "\n In colorectal cancer, C14orf28 is upregulated in tumor tissues relative to adjacent non-tumor areas. Functional studies demonstrate that its overexpression enhances cellular proliferation, migration, and invasion while inhibiting apoptosis and promoting the epithelial–mesenchymal transition (EMT). Its activity is also subject to post-transcriptional regulation by miR-519d, and modulation of C14orf28 levels appears to be critical for the aggressive phenotype of colorectal cancer cells."}, {"type": "fg", "children": [{"type": "fg_f", "ref": "2"}]}, {"type": "t", "text": "\n "}]}, {"type": "t", "text": "\n \n "}, {"type": "p", "children": [{"type": "t", "text": "\n Moreover, in hypoxic colorectal cancer cells, the transcription factor FOXA2 upregulates hsa-let-7g, which in turn downregulates C14orf28. This cascade contributes to the inhibition of hypoxia-induced EMT, underscoring a role for C14orf28 in mediating cellular plasticity under stress conditions."}, {"type": "fg", "children": [{"type": "fg_f", "ref": "3"}]}, {"type": "t", "text": "\n "}]}, {"type": "t", "text": "\n \n "}, {"type": "p", "children": [{"type": "t", "text": "\n Overall, these findings indicate that C14orf28/DRIP1 is an important modulator of cell signaling pathways implicated in both neuronal function and cancer progression, warranting further investigation into its mechanism of action and potential as a therapeutic target."}, {"type": "fg", "children": [{"type": "fg_fs", "start_ref": "1", "end_ref": "3"}]}, {"type": "t", "text": "\n "}]}, {"type": "rg", "children": [{"type": "r", "ref": 1, "children": [{"type": "t", "text": "L Zhan, J R Kerr, M-J Lafuente, et al.
